In December 2025, human remains were identified as those of William Ott, a skilled hiker who vanished during his quest for ancient rock art in the Grand Canyon back in April 2012. The search for Ott concluded after his daypack was discovered nearby, containing personal items. Authorities used DNA testing to confirm his identity after years of searching for answers.
